Duke University was established in 1924 and is based in Durham, North Carolina. It is a private research university that currently has an enrollment of 12,991 students. The university operates via various institutes: Asian/Pacific Studies, Institute for Genome Sciences & Policy, John Hope Franklin Humanities Institute, Kenan Institute for Ethics, Social Science Research Institute and Terry Sanford Institute of Public Policy. Academic programs are offered in the fields of Arts & Sciences, Law, Medicine, Nursing, Environment and Earth Sciences.
